3 People Living at 2417 W Center Street, Decatur, IL

Address History: 2417 W Center Street, Decatur, IL 62526; 3869 E Fulton Avenue, Decatur, IL 62521; Moweaqua, IL 62550; Tamaroa, IL 62888; Indianapolis, IN 46237
Aliases (AKA): T L Sheets, Terry Sheets
Relatives & Associates: Trisha Baang Alice Kerns Andrew Sheets Andrew Sheets Gary Sheets

Results 1 - 3 of 3